Lauren Branning is seen trying her luck at securing a new job in the upcoming EastEnders episodes, however, concerns about her son create friction with the Beales.

On Monday (July 15), Lauren becomes anxious as her job interview approaches but her day takes a turn for the worse when bailiffs show up at her doorstep demanding payment for an old credit debt.

Later, she is surprised to see her son Louie playing football with Junior Knight, Alfie Moon and Tommy in the Square.

The situation deteriorates further when a conversation with Junior escalates after he begins questioning Louie's academic abilities, leading Lauren to walk away.

Penny Branning attempts to mediate, siding with Junior's concern that Louie might be having difficulties at school.

Following a discussion with Kathy Beale, a tense Lauren softens upon receiving some advice. She then heads to The Queen Vic to apologise to Junior, where they share a drink and he offers her some encouraging words.

Later in the week, Lauren seizes an opportunity by asking Jay Brown for a trial shift at the Car Lot, which he agrees to.

However, upon discovering that Louie has been struggling at school, she ends up clashing with Kathy, mistakenly believing she is being insensitive about Louie's diagnosis.

Junior encounters Lauren again, and they exchange numbers when Junior suggests connecting her with a friend of Xavier's who could help Louie.

Lauren's boyfriend, Peter Beale, steps in, but after being away from Walford for two days, Lauren is not in the mood for sarcasm and storms out with Louie.

Peter tries to show his support for Lauren and Louie, but she storms off when he unintentionally offends her before her trial shift.

In an attempt to reconcile with Junior, Peter heads to The Vic where they share a pint before going to pick up Louie from school.

Later at the cafe, Peter apologises to Lauren and proposes moving in together, but she requests time to consider.

With Junior already known as a ladies' man in Walford, is he trying to win Lauren's heart?

Or will Lauren agree to Peter's proposal to live together as a family?

These EastEnders scenes air from Monday, July 15 on BBC One and BBC iPlayer.
